Based on the most helpful WSO content, there isn't specific information about the 2027 SA timeline for Toronto in the provided context. However, for previous years like 2024, timelines and updates varied by bank. For example:

  • CIBC: Completed SA24 recruiting early and opened off-cycle roles later.
  • Scotiabank: Historically, applications opened, but interviews were delayed.
  • TD: Diversity interviews were reviewed first, with general interviews following later.
  • RBC: Diversity offers were sent out early, with non-accelerated rounds following.

Recruiting timelines often depend on the bank and whether you're applying through diversity or general processes. If you're targeting Toronto, it's crucial to stay proactive with networking and monitor updates from specific banks.

Most relevant globals pretty much done. Rothschild has sent out cocktail invites. Scotia is running R2s rn, BMO has started for the prep lab or something, TD BTG SDs are out, NBF running in March, CIBC had a cocktail too or something, RBC no idea
